Publisher's summary

A woman on a dangerous mission to a new world.

A warrior sworn to protect her who fears to risk his heart.

Can Whitney and Rafe escape from the giant beings who have captured them?

And will Whitney end up...pairing with her protector?

Dr. Whitney Washington is a Xeno-zoologist living on the Kindred Mother Ship, and she has a big problem - she has a crush on her bodyguard. Unfortunately, the big Beast Kindred who comes with her to dangerous planets to protect her clearly doesn't return her interest...or does he?

Rafe is a warrior with a past - a bad one. He has been hurt before when dealing with females, and he doesn't intend to repeat the experience. But it's hard to ignore Whitney's beauty and bubbly personality. Still, he's determined to try until an unexpected turn in their latest trip to a new planet for research changes everything.

Forced to land on an unknown world, Whitney and Rafe find themselves among a group of feral humanoids who seem to be about as smart as house cats. Soon they are mistaken for pets by the huge aliens who live on the planet and taken into captivity as a "mating pair". But what will happen when Rafe and Whitney actually have to mate in order to escape?

You'll have to listen to Pairing with the Protector to find out....

ridiculous even for romance fiction

I listened to several EA books only to find them more ridiculous as the series progresses. I had to give up before the third chapter.
The seemingly intelligent females constantly get themselves into ridiculous situations where the big strong warrior has to save them but not before getting naked ( this time being stripped by a 4 year old child) to be put with other " breeders". that is as far as I got. but I can guess that they will end up having to eat something disgusting and perform sexually in some awkward situations. I could be wrong... thankfully I won't be finding out.

female lead acts like a 14 y/o

Story was interesting up until the end. Whitney basically forces Rafe to bond with her. Then when she realizes he didn't want to be bonded she ignores him, acting like a melodramatic teen. On their way home she makes it clear to Rafe they won't be living together and even plans to not tell him about his children (which really pisses me off). Once she makes it clear she wants nothing to do with him he offers to break their bond so she won't be stuck in a relationship she doesn't want she throws a fit. I HATE people who act like this. Anything Rafe would have said or done would make her mad and act like he was the one being an @$$hole when it was her. This plot development ruined what was otherwise a fun and funny story. I know it's just a story, but I'm seriously pissed off. I don't recommend this book. Whitney is a horrible example of a woman.
